WebKeep Your Pooch from Chewing Itself. To help our pooch relieve himself from the itch, get rid of the fur in the sore area. We can use mild shampoo and keep the area dry. To prevent our dog from scratching itself, we can use e-collars or Elizabethan collars. WebNov 1, 2024 · The urge to protect the people in its pack, its food, or some prized possession may provoke your dog to attack another dog. Overstimulation and what may have started out as friendly play can go too far, and a fight may break out. Redirected aggression is common among dogs that are normally friendly or live together.
